Thermax™ HTS1 High-Temp Support Filament [1010 Break Away Support]
Our break away high-temp support filament is ideal for use in dual extruder 3D printers designed to print high-temp materials.
HTS is the premium support for our high-temp products, unlike most support filaments, which are not designed to withstand the heat required to print the top-end of performance materials.

Support Removal:
- This is break-away support and does not dissolve.
- High-Temp support is best removed while printed part is still warm.
- If the finished printed part cools completely and the support removal gets too difficult, you can re-warm the part in the printer chamber or an oven not exceeding the Tg of the model material you are printing with.

Filament Specifications:
1.75mm and 2.85mm +/- 0.05mm in diameter
Recommended Print Settings:
- Extruder: 350-380°C
- Bed Temp: 120-160°C
- Bed Prep: Nano Polymer Adhesive or Polyimide Tape gives us the best results.
- Heated Chamber: All high-temp materials print better with a heated enclosure or build environment. Enclosure temp should not exceed 185°C for our high-temp support material to remain structurally sound as a support.
- Other: Don’t use a cooling fan while printing this support.
- Drying Instructions: 120°C for 4 hours
